BC wildfire information and resources

Aug. 17, 2018 - Wildfire activity in the Province of BC continues to be volatile. The Regional District of Bulkley-Nechako issued an evacuation alert on August 12, 2018, including the town of Fort St James and the Conifex Fort St James mill and the BC Government issued a province-wide state of emergency on August 15, 2018.

As we are anticipating an evacuation order, Conifex Timber has temporarily suspended operations at the Fort St. James mill site.

Asset protection will be in place 24/7.  We have an onsite team conducting fire protection tasks who are working closely with the Provincial and local Incident Management Teams.

The health, safety, and well-being of our employees and families is paramount.
